Major Industries Contributing to Florida’s Economic Growth
The table below highlights the major industries contributing to Florida’s economic growth in 2021:
| Industry | Growth Rate (%) | Key Statistics |
|---|---|---|
| Tourism | 8.2% | Over 126 million visitors in 2021, generating $91.5 billion in revenue |
| Healthcare | 7.1% | Florida’s healthcare industry employed over 1.1 million people in 2021 |
| Technology | 12.3% | Florida’s tech industry attracted over $1.1 billion in investments in 2021 |
| International Trade | 9.5% | Florida’s international trade industry generated over $143 billion in revenue in 2021 |
